Power system is the most important method for resorce and energy optimization.Remote transimiting electricity and power system interconnectionthe theme of modern power system evolution.But the interconnecttion lead to partial fault evolving to extensiveness,and lead to the blackout.After line tripping happens in power system,loading flows in system.The load in the tripped line may transfer to other lines,leading overloading with the characteristic of low-voltage and over-current.The transformation of measured impedance in impedance ichnography for overloading and the one for fault are similar,which results in the maloperation of distance protection ? and chain tripping.So the analysis and countermeasure to distance protection maloperation in overloading,and the improvement to the performance of distance protection answering overloading are important to prevent distance protection maloperation.The artical firstly analyze generic overloading model,set up PSCAD overloading model basing on the difference of the voltage of two sides of system,and analyze the character of measured impedance.In case of the difference of the voltage of two sides of system,the distance protecion ? may maloperate for overloading.Experiment with alternate impedance relay and grounding impedance relay andverifies the results of PSCAD model.erOn the basis of PSCAD and experiment,the artical puts forward voltage limitation and voltage limitation,analyze the area of inpedance relay maloperation in impedance ichnography.Then the artical put forward a self-adaption inpedance protection project to remove the maloperating area,to solve the distance protection maloperation in overloading.
